Transaction 31e9d7bf98145f00e81060b52609563c132fc71550779b9be4b85817e0727b50

1 Input
2 Outputs
  • 31e9d7bf98145f00e81060b52609563c132fc71550779b9be4b85817e0727b50:0
  • value  888382706
    address  1qRKEaF48siYrq22SRnyWGQYQWejgAaDU
  • 31e9d7bf98145f00e81060b52609563c132fc71550779b9be4b85817e0727b50:1
  • value  147289
    address  12HvCgTL82uH7J7S8nkHb9mvDJaeoH53iG